Description:
L-Proline, phenylmethyl ester, hydrochloride (1:1) is a chemical compound characterized by its structure, which includes the amino acid proline modified with a phenylmethyl (benzyl) ester group and a hydrochloride salt form. This compound typically appears as a white to off-white crystalline powder and is soluble in water, reflecting its ionic nature due to the presence of the hydrochloride. It is often used in biochemical and pharmaceutical applications, particularly in peptide synthesis and as a building block in organic chemistry. The presence of the proline moiety contributes to its role in stabilizing protein structures, while the phenylmethyl group can enhance lipophilicity, influencing its interaction with biological membranes. As with many amino acid derivatives, it may exhibit specific biological activities, including potential roles in neurotransmission or metabolic pathways. Safety data should be consulted for handling and storage, as with all chemical substances, to ensure proper laboratory practices.
